About ViaSat

ViaSat is a global communications company that provides satellite and wireless networking technology, services, and solutions. The company was founded in 1986 and is headquartered in Carlsbad, California. ViaSat offers a range of products and services, including satellite broadband internet, in-flight Wi-Fi, and secure networking systems for government and military customers. The company has more than 6,200 employees and operates in over 50 countries. ViaSat is publicly traded on the NASDAQ stock exchange under the ticker symbol VSAT.
